April marks the beginning of the annual Division of Housing and Community Renewal (DHCR) rent registration season. Owners and/or managing agents of all rent stabilized housing accommodations including SRO's and co-op/condos must register the units with DHCR. Some important facts are as follows:
All information provided is to be as of April 1, 2000. This is a point that many owners miss. Fill out all forms as of April 1, 2000. This includes tenants that you know have moved in or out subsequent to April 1, 2000. DHCR wants the status of your buildings as of April 1, 2000, period.
Forms and instructions are available from any DHCR Borough or District rent office (listed below) during business hours. Owners and managers of fifty (50) or fewer units may have forms mailed by calling (718) 739-6400.

Managers should have last year's registrations and a rent roll (as of April 1, 2000) prior to starting the project. If you do not have last year's records you can get a printout by requesting it in person at any of the Borough or District Rent offices. The summary form must be notarized.
